Output 21ba7c107577792d25a5d856a5c5adccaa1616e032ae14231ca30366bfa2ab08:7

value
25216952885
script pubkey
OP_0 OP_PUSHBYTES_20 78c952ac7fe131c9a9e3e9da3d59a43b9c0b8ac6
address
ltc1q0ry49trluycun20ra8dr6kdy8wwqhzkxxg3svx
transaction
21ba7c107577792d25a5d856a5c5adccaa1616e032ae14231ca30366bfa2ab08
spent
true